Leading Advanced Socio-Technical System 7.5 credits

Course content

The course includes theories and methods for leadership using a socio-technical perspective. The following are examples of concepts and terms included in the course. -leadership and complexity -change and transformation -learning in organizations -dealing with uncertainty -activity centered design -introducing new advanced technology -team effectiveness

Entry requirements

The applicant must hold the minimum of a bachelor’s degree (i.e the equivalent of 180 ECTS credits at an accredited university) in engineering or technology. The bachelor’s degree should comprise a minimum of 15 credits in mathematics, and taken course Leading Sustainable Operations, 7.5 credits or the equivalent.. Proof of English proficiency is required.
